System.Machine.PowerStatus Object

Defines the properties and events for the computer's power status.

Members

The System.Machine.PowerStatus object defines the following members:

  • Properties
  • Events

Properties

The System.Machine.PowerStatus object defines the following properties.

Property Access type Description

batteryCapacityRemaining

Read-only

Gets the remaining capacity of the computer battery in seconds.

batteryCapacityTotal

Read-only

Gets the total capacity of the computer battery in seconds.

batteryPercentRemaining

Read-only

Gets the remaining capacity of the computer battery as a percentage of total capacity.

batteryStatus

Read-only

Gets the charge state of the computer's battery.

isBatteryCharging

Read-only

Gets the battery charging status.

isPowerLineConnected

Read-only

Gets the power supply state.

 

Events

The System.Machine.PowerStatus object defines the following event.

Event Description
powerLineStatusChanged

Event fired when the computer's power supply state changes between plugged-in and battery-powered.

 

Requirements

Minimum supported client Windows Vista
Minimum supported server Windows Server 2008
IDL Sidebar.idl
DLL Sidebar.Exe version 1.0 or later

 

 

Send comments about this topic to Microsoft

Build date: 2/24/2010

Build type: SDK